Int'l children's film festival closes in east China

An international children's film festival closed Saturday evening in east China's Jiangsu Province.

More than 60 movies from 22 countries and regions attended the 11th China International Children's Festival held in the city of Jiangyin.

At the five-day event, 10 awards have gone to movies and performers from Russia, Germany, Argentina, the United States, Finland, Hungary and China.

Further, "Niko and the way to the star" from Finland, "The crocodiles" from Germany, and Zhang Zhuang from China-made "Kung Fu kids" have won children's favorite cartoon, movie and child actor, selected by a jury of 230 local children.

Initiated in 1989, the biennial festival has attracted 190 movies from the world to attend.
